Interesting Facts about Howard County

As of 2011, Howard County's population is 279,259 people. Since 2000, it has had a population growth of 12.70 percent.

--------------------

The median home cost in Howard County is $403,400. Home appreciation the last year has been -4.18 percent.

--------------------

Compared to the rest of the country, Howard County's cost of living is 38.60% Higher than the U.S. average.

--------------------

Howard County public schools spend $7,362 per student. The average school expenditure in the U.S. is $5,678. There are about 14.2 students per teacher in Howard County.

--------------------

The unemployment rate in Howard County is 5.10 percent(U.S. avg. is 9.10%). Recent job growth is Positive. Howard County jobs have Increased by 0.12 percent.

Average Commute time is 33 minutes. The National Average is 28 minutes.
